The house is located at Svatoslavova 609/5, Nusle, 140 00 Prague 4, on a plot with parcel number 604, cadastral area Nusle. The garage option is just 3 minutes away.

The location of this house between parks and at the foot of a villa quarter means daily walks through a green oasis within a vibrant city. Thanks to its location, you can enjoy a panoramic view of Grébovka (Havlíčkovy sady) and the surroundings of the noble old Vršovice area, offering an unparalleled panorama. The house is strategically situated between the park at Generál Kutlvašr Square with a fountain and two ponds, where water cascades over a rounded plate with “rakes” into the lower part, and the park along Pod Vilami Street. This not only provides an aesthetic experience but also a connection with nature and a peaceful environment.

In the vicinity, there are numerous cafes, restaurants, shops, and services, along with civic amenities such as schools. Noteworthy places include Dhaba Beas, a popular vegetarian restaurant not only serving Indian cuisine, and the legendary Zelenkova confectionery. Public transportation includes the C line metro accessible within around a 10-minute walk (Vyšehrad or Pražského povstání) and a tram stop within 3 minutes.

On the opposite slope, where the view from the living room with a terrace is mentioned above, lies Grébovka Park in a neo-Renaissance style spanning 11 hectares, with 1.7 hectares dedicated to vineyards. Within the park, you’ll find Gröbe’s villa, the Pavilion, vineyards with the Vinicultural Pavilion, Grotto, and the Upper and Lower Landhauska estates and wine cellar. This entire complex forms a panorama while sitting on the sofa in the living room or on the terrace.
